The game itself is a great "Soulslike" in a sci-fi setting with exo-rigs instead of armor, just like the first one, while improving on nearly everything. If you like those kind of games, buy it. I didn't have any crashes in 50h+, but the game tends to freeze for 2-4 Seconds on the first few dismemberments after entering a new zone.

The worst enemy by far in this game is the camera. When you have a target locked and there is a hint of a wall in a 5 km radius, you won't be able to see anything. But the wall. No boss, no jump, no group of enemies is responsible for more of my deaths.
..and the directional blocking. The system by itself works fine, once you got the timings down. The problem is the controlsceme, at least on XBox controllers: You block by holding LB and then moving the right stick at the correct time in the correct direction....the right stick also moves the camera when unlocked, chooses your targeted bodypart when locked, and pressing it unlocks. Meaning when you block with gusto you are very likely to change your targeted limb or even lose your lock completely and spin the camera satan knows where.
